Senator John Kerry's Offensive Remarks

"You know, education, if you make the most of it, you study hard, you do your homework and you make an effort to be smart, you can do well. If you don't, you get stuck in Iraq." This comment has been broadcasted across the airwaves of television and radio during the past 24 hours. Senator John Kerry of Massachusettes made this comment to a group of students just yesterday during a speech he was giving to promote some of his fellow democratic candidates for the upcoming elections next week.
